- The distance between North Loup, Ne, Usa and Santarem, Brazil is approximately 6,648 km or 4,131 mi.
- To reach North Loup, Ne in this distance one would set out from Santarem bearing 323.1°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ach North Loup, Ne bearing 306.2° or NW .
- North Loup, Ne has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Santarem has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
- The average annual temperature is 16.3 °C (29.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 27.5 °C (49.5°F) more in North Loup, Ne.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1361.3 mm (53.6 in) less which is equivalent to 1361.3 l/m² (33.41 US gal/ft²) or 13,613,000 l/ha (1,455,320 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 26.5° lower in North Loup, Ne than in Santarem.
